+/* $NetBSD: h_forkcli.c,v 1.1 2011/01/05 17:19:09 pooka Exp $ */
+
+#include <sys/types.h>
+#include <sys/wait.h>
+
+#include <err.h>
+#include <errno.h>
+#include <fcntl.h>
+#include <stdlib.h>
+#include <stdio.h>
+#include <string.h>
+#include <unistd.h>
+
+#include <rump/rump_syscalls.h>
+#include <rump/rumpclient.h>
+
+static void
+simple(void)
+{
+ struct rumpclient_fork *rf;
+ pid_t pid1, pid2;
+ int fd, status;
+
+ if ((pid1 = rump_sys_getpid()) < 2)
+ errx(1, "unexpected pid %d", pid1);
+
+ fd = rump_sys_open("/dev/null", O_CREAT | O_RDWR);
+ if (rump_sys_write(fd, &fd, sizeof(fd)) != sizeof(fd))
+ errx(1, "write newlyopened /dev/null");
+
+ if ((rf = rumpclient_prefork()) == NULL)
+ err(1, "prefork");
+
+ switch (fork()) {
+ case -1:
+ err(1, "fork");
+ break;
+ case 0:
+ if (rumpclient_fork_init(rf) == -1)
+ err(1, "postfork init failed");
+
+ if ((pid2 = rump_sys_getpid()) < 2)
+ errx(1, "unexpected pid %d", pid2);
+ if (pid1 == pid2)
+ errx(1, "child and parent pids are equal");
+
+ /* check that we can access the fd, the close it and exit */
+ if (rump_sys_write(fd, &fd, sizeof(fd)) != sizeof(fd))
+ errx(1, "write child /dev/null");
+ rump_sys_close(fd);
+ break;
+ default:
+ /*
+ * check that we can access the fd, wait for the child, and
+ * check we can still access the fd
+ */
+ if (rump_sys_write(fd, &fd, sizeof(fd)) != sizeof(fd))
+ errx(1, "write parent /dev/null");
+ if (wait(&status) == -1)
+ err(1, "wait failed");
+ if (!WIFEXITED(status) || WEXITSTATUS(status) != 0)
+ errx(1, "child exited with status %d", status);
+ if (rump_sys_write(fd, &fd, sizeof(fd)) != sizeof(fd))
+ errx(1, "write parent /dev/null");
+ break;
+ }
+}
+
+static void
+cancel(void)
+{
+
+ /* XXX: not implemented in client / server !!! */
+}
+
+#define TESTSTR "i am your fatherrrrrrr"
+#define TESTSLEN (sizeof(TESTSTR)-1)
+static void
+pipecomm(void)
+{
+ struct rumpclient_fork *rf;
+ char buf[TESTSLEN+1];
+ int pipetti[2];
+ int status;
+
+ if (rump_sys_pipe(pipetti) == -1)
+ errx(1, "pipe");
+
+ if ((rf = rumpclient_prefork()) == NULL)
+ err(1, "prefork");
+
+ switch (fork()) {
+ case -1:
+ err(1, "fork");
+ break;
+ case 0:
+ if (rumpclient_fork_init(rf) == -1)
+ err(1, "postfork init failed");
+
+ memset(buf, 0, sizeof(buf));
+ if (rump_sys_read(pipetti[0], buf, TESTSLEN) != TESTSLEN)
+ err(1, "pipe read");
+ if (strcmp(TESTSTR, buf) != 0)
+ errx(1, "teststring doesn't match, got %s", buf);
+ break;
+ default:
+ if (rump_sys_write(pipetti[1], TESTSTR, TESTSLEN) != TESTSLEN)
+ err(1, "pipe write");
+ if (wait(&status) == -1)
+ err(1, "wait failed");
+ if (!WIFEXITED(status) || WEXITSTATUS(status) != 0)
+ errx(1, "child exited with status %d", status);
+ break;
+ }
+}
+
+static void
+fakeauth(void)
+{
+ struct rumpclient_fork *rf;
+ uint32_t *auth;
+ int rv;
+
+ if ((rf = rumpclient_prefork()) == NULL)
+ err(1, "prefork");
+
+ /* XXX: we know the internal structure of rf */
+ auth = (void *)rf;
+ *(auth+3) = *(auth+3) ^ 0x1;
+
+ rv = rumpclient_fork_init(rf);
+ if (!(rv == -1 && errno == ESRCH))
+ exit(1);
+}
+
+struct parsa {
+ const char *arg; /* sp arg, el */
+ void (*spring)(void); /* spring into action */
+} paragus[] = {
+ { "simple", simple },
+ { "cancel", cancel },
+ { "pipecomm", pipecomm },
+ { "fakeauth", fakeauth },
+};
+
+int
+main(int argc, char *argv[])
+{
+ unsigned i;
+
+ if (argc != 2)
+ errx(1, "invalid usage");
+
+ if (rumpclient_init() == -1)
+ err(1, "rumpclient init");
+
+ for (i = 0; i < __arraycount(paragus); i++) {
+ if (strcmp(argv[1], paragus[i].arg) == 0) {
+ paragus[i].spring();
+ break;
+ }
+ }
+ if (i == __arraycount(paragus)) {
+ printf("invalid test %s\n", argv[1]);
+ exit(1);
+ }
+
+ exit(0);
+}
